What to Expect from Commercial Construction Services in Los Angeles
When you hire a company for commercial construction services in Los Angeles, you’re tapping into a full spectrum of expertise. From initial design concepts to the final walkthrough, these services cover every step of the process.
Planning and Design
The first phase involves understanding your vision and goals. A good construction team will collaborate with architects and designers to create plans that maximize space, functionality, and aesthetics. This stage often includes:
Site analysis and feasibility studies
Budget planning and cost estimation
Design drafts and revisions
Permitting and Compliance
Navigating the permitting process in Los Angeles can be complex. Experienced builders handle all the paperwork and inspections required by city authorities. This ensures your project complies with zoning laws, safety standards, and environmental regulations.
Construction and Project Management
Once permits are secured, construction begins. Skilled project managers coordinate subcontractors, schedule deliveries, and monitor progress to keep everything on track. Regular updates and transparent communication help you stay informed and confident throughout the build.
Finishing Touches and Quality Control
The final phase focuses on details like interior finishes, landscaping, and final inspections. Quality control checks guarantee that every element meets your expectations and industry standards.

How to Prepare for Your Commercial Construction Project
Preparation is essential for a smooth construction experience. Here are some practical steps to get ready:
Define Your Goals Clearly
Write down what you want to achieve with your renovation or new build. Include must-haves, budget limits, and timeline expectations.
Secure Financing
Make sure your funding is in place before starting. This avoids interruptions and stress during construction.
Choose Your Team Early
Engage your construction company and design professionals early to benefit from their input during planning.
Plan for Disruptions
Construction can be noisy and messy. If your business will remain open during the project, plan how to minimize impact on customers and staff.
Stay Involved
Regular site visits and meetings with your project manager help you stay informed and address issues promptly.
